Amplify Event Attendance Through Email Marketing Workflow
Planning a successful event requires meticulous organization, from registration to follow-up. Email marketing plays a crucial role in this process, helping you engage attendees and foster excitement before, during, and after the event email marketing event. A comprehensive email marketing workflow can streamline your efforts, ensuring a smooth and impactful experience for everyone involved.
- Kickstart your email campaign with compelling registration emails that clearly outline the event's value proposition, schedule, and benefits. Include visually appealing images to capture attention and encourage sign-ups.
- Divide your audience based on their interests and engagement levels. This allows you to tailor email content specifically to different groups, boosting relevance and open rates.
- Deliver pre-event reminders that highlight key details like the date, time, location, and agenda. Provide practical information such as parking instructions, dress code, or required items to bring.
- Utilize social media channels to promote your event and stimulate buzz among potential attendees. Share engaging content, run contests, and interact with followers to broaden your reach.
- After the Conclusion of the Event emails should express gratitude for attendance and share key takeaways from the event. Include photos, videos, or presentations to help attendees relive the experience.
Continue the conversation with attendees by offering exclusive content, invitations to future events, or discounts on products or services. This fosters a sense of community and encourages engagement.
